Jieshou ( Chinese  界首 市 , Pinyin Jièshǒu Shì ) is an independent city in the northwest of the Chinese province of Anhui . It belongs to the administrative area of ​​the prefecture-level city of Fuyang . Jieshou has an area of ​​667 km² and about 760,000 inhabitants (end of 2007).

Administrative structure

At the community level, Jieshou consists of three street districts , twelve large communities and three communities . These are:

Dongcheng Street (东城 街道), seat of the city government;
Xicheng Street (西城 街道);
Yingnan Street District (颍 南 街道);
Greater community Dahuang (大黄镇);
Greater community Daiqiao (代桥镇);
Greater community Guangwu (光武镇);
Greater community Guji (顾集镇);
Lucun municipality (芦 村镇);
Greater community Quanyang (泉阳镇);
Greater community Shuzhuang (舒庄镇);
Greater community Taomiao (陶庙镇);
Greater community Tianying (田营镇);
Greater community Wangji (王集镇);
Greater community Xinmaji (新马集镇);
Greater community Zhuanji (砖集镇);
Community Bingji (邴集乡);
Community Jinzhai (靳寨乡);
Renzhai municipality (任寨乡).

economy

Jieshou, together with the nearby cities of Taihe and Fuyang, forms a center of the Chinese lead industry . Around half of China's lead production comes from the area of ​​these three cities.
